Apple Poised to Overtake Samsung in 2025

Recent analysis from Counterpoint Research suggests that Apple is poised to redefine the landscape of the global smartphone market. The latest forecast reveals that the groundbreaking iPhone 17 lineup could enable Apple to overtake Samsung, clinching the title of the world’s foremost phone manufacturer for the first time in over a decade. With a projected shipment of 243 million units in 2025, Apple is anticipated to secure an impressive 19.4% share of the international smartphone market, subtly outpacing Samsung’s expected 235 million shipments.

The surge in iPhone 17 popularity has been remarkable, with sales figures indicating a 12% increase in its debut month when compared to previous models. This exponential growth is partially attributed to the limited impact of tariffs and a streamlining of supply chain efficiencies, factors that have allowed Apple to maintain its competitive edge within the luxury smartphone segment. Despite industry skepticism concerning the reception of the iPhone Air and the company’s advancements in artificial intelligence, Apple’s consistent commitment to innovation continues to resonate with discerning consumers.

Looking ahead, anticipation is building as Apple plans to introduce the affordable “iPhone 17e” by spring 2026, further expanding their distinguished portfolio. Moreover, whispers within the industry indicate that Apple is diligently developing its inaugural foldable iPhone, signaling a bold step into a new frontier of design excellence and technological sophistication.
